J HAVE pleasure in announcing that I have <uimitted into partnership Mr. Campbell McCormick, who for some time past has been my Managing Clerk. The practice will in future be carried on under the style or firm of CROKER & McCORMICK, Barristers and Solicitors, New Plymouth. C. H. CROKER. Barrister and Solicitor, National Bank Chambers, Brougham Street, New Plymouth.
